Born and raised in Oregon, Richard has been painting on canvas since the age of 14. Getting a BSA degree in business and focused on art from Montana state university, he moved to San Diego to procure his dream of being an artist.

After working in a screen-printing shop, he was hired by Shane Bowden as an art apprentice. He learned and painted for four years under Shane and showed work in galleries all around the world, San Diego, Los Angeles, San Francisco, New York, Toronto, London, Tokyo, Asaka Japan, Hong Kong, and Singapore.

He moved back to his hometown of Bend, Oregon, and opened his first solo studio. Now after three years, he’s back in southern California and has opened his new studio to start work on new collections and ideas.
